Credit broker Smava takes over competitor Finanzcheck

Merger in the fintech industry: consumer credit portal Smava wants to take over its competitor Finanzcheck. This will create a leading provider for brokering loans via the Internet, Smava announced in Berlin on Friday. The seller of Finanzcheck - not to be confused with Check24 - is the financial investor Hellman & Friedman. Smava did not provide details of the purchase price - according to financial circles, it amounts to around 200 million euros. The transaction is expected to be completed by the end of the first quarter.

 


Hellman & Friedman will receive a minority stake in Smava as part of the acquisition. Finanzcheck and Smava reportedly brokered a total of more than 4 billion euros in loans last year - with Smava accounting for around 65 percent. According to the report, the two companies have grown recently and expanded their market shares. Finanzcheck was founded in Hamburg in 2011 and has already changed hands twice in the past almost three years.

 

The consumer credit market is shifting increasingly quickly to the Internet," the statement said. Despite the growth of loans brokered via the Internet, the majority of deals were still done in bank branches, according to experts. However, this could change significantly in the coming years.
